Can’t believe he was 28 with his first Dakar. Imagine if he started earlier.
Results are
Every time he’s finished has been on the podium.
2020: 3rd (2 stage wins)
2019: 1st (1 stage win) with his wrist falling apart
2018: 3rd
2017: ab stage 4 (5th)
2016: 1st
2015: 3rd

Michael McDowell, who led only one lap — the final lap, which resulted in a fiery multicar crash — seemingly snuck out of nowhere to win the Daytona 500, the first victory of his 14-year career.
“I just can’t believe it,” McDowell admitted to Fox Sports’s Jamie Little after the race. “Just gotta thank God. So many years just grinding it out, hoping for an opportunity like this. . . I’m so thankful. Such a great way to get a first victory. Daytona 500, are you kidding me?!”
